Citrate (Si)-synthase CIT2 YCR005C

Summary

Citrate (Si)-synthase CIT2 YCR005C is a protein[1].

Key Facts

  • Citrate (Si)-synthase CIT2 YCR005C's instance of is recorded as protein[2].
  • Citrate (Si)-synthase CIT2 YCR005C's subclass of is recorded as protein[3].
  • Citrate (Si)-synthase CIT2 YCR005C's UniProt protein ID is recorded as P08679[4].
  • Citrate (Si)-synthase CIT2 YCR005C's part of is recorded as Citrate synthase-like, small alpha subdomain[5].
  • Citrate (Si)-synthase CIT2 YCR005C's part of is recorded as Citrate synthase superfamily[6].
  • Citrate (Si)-synthase CIT2 YCR005C's part of is recorded as Citrate synthase, eukaryotic-type[7].
  • Citrate (Si)-synthase CIT2 YCR005C's part of is recorded as Citrate synthase-like, large alpha subdomain[8].
  • Citrate (Si)-synthase CIT2 YCR005C's part of is recorded as Citrate synthase active site, protein family[9].
  • Citrate (Si)-synthase CIT2 YCR005C's has part is recorded as Citrate synthase active site[10].
  • Citrate (Si)-synthase CIT2 YCR005C's RefSeq protein ID is recorded as NP_009931[11].
  • Citrate (Si)-synthase CIT2 YCR005C's molecular function is recorded as transferase activity[12].
  • Citrate (Si)-synthase CIT2 YCR005C's molecular function is recorded as acyltransferase, acyl groups converted into alkyl on transfer[13].
  • Citrate (Si)-synthase CIT2 YCR005C's molecular function is recorded as citrate (Si)-synthase activity[14].
  • Citrate (Si)-synthase CIT2 YCR005C's molecular function is recorded as citrate (Si)-synthase activity[15].
  • Citrate (Si)-synthase CIT2 YCR005C's cell component is recorded as peroxisome[16].
  • Citrate (Si)-synthase CIT2 YCR005C's cell component is recorded as cytoplasm[17].
  • Citrate (Si)-synthase CIT2 YCR005C's cell component is recorded as mitochondrial matrix[18].
  • Citrate (Si)-synthase CIT2 YCR005C's cell component is recorded as mitochondrion[19].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as glyoxylate cycle[20].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as glutamate biosynthetic process[21].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as tricarboxylic acid cycle[22].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as citrate metabolic process[23].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as carbohydrate metabolic process[24].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as tricarboxylic acid cycle[25].
  • Citrate (Si)-synthase CIT2 YCR005C's biological process is recorded as citrate metabolic process[26].
